City Suspends Effective Date of TGS GRIP Rate Hike
Trusted by teams at
Description
Horizon City will suspend for 45 days the effective date of Texas Gas Service Company’s 2026 GRIP interim rate adjustment application, delaying the proposed gas rate increases from May 9, 2026, to June 23, 2026. The suspension allows the City time to review the company’s data, calculations, and statutory compliance before the new rates take effect.

Renewal Info
Suspension is a procedural action under Texas Utilities Code §104.301 and does not itself change the underlying tariff; interim rate adjustment remains pending before the Railroad Commission.
